Mark Rothko aimed to create paintings that achieved his ideal of “the simple expression of the complex thought.” His signature compositions of two to four rectangular forms, aligned vertically against a color ground, create wide-ranging moods and atmospheric effects. Contemplating a Rothko painting can be akin to a spiritual experience. This book of postcards pays homage to the revolutionary abstract expressionist with 30 reproductions of his paintings.
